MINNEAPOLIS (AP) - Authorities say human remains found in state park in northeastern Minnesota are that of a Minneapolis woman who disappeared 30 years ago.

Cassandra Rhines was 19 years old when she went missing in June 1985. Her remains were found last May in Gooseberry Falls State Park in Lake County. The remains were identified through DNA.

Authorities say Rhines was killed, and they are investigating her death as a homicide.

Investigators believe Rhines may have been involved in prostitution and worked as an exotic dancer. She also may have been living with a man. Authorities are seeking the public's help in identifying that man to see if he knows what happened.
